PULS

A modular, truck-mounted multiple launch rocket system that can switch between rocket and ballistic missile pod configurations to strike targets at ranges from roughly 20 to over 300 kilometers. It has been adopted by several export customers seeking a flexible, containerized long-range fires platform.

In service since 2018 · 4 operator countries
